    can't add known know cousins

    I'm pretty sure I have my group admin account setup correctly but when I try to add my known cousins is where I must be doing something wrong. I have around 14 - 1st cousins and my 95 year old uncle added to FTDNA but when I follow the directions but when I sign in using these directions it won't let me add any of my cousins,

    Sign in to your GAP account using your GAP username and password.
    On the GAP homepage, click MY ACCOUNT on the menu bar, and select Add Projects.
    In the DKit and Code fields, enter the temporary ID and password, respectively, contained in the new project email you received.
    Click Add Project.

    When I check on my cousins I need to sign in and out to look at them. What the heck am I doing wrong?
    Rich

    You need to add them to the project individually.

    You can do it one of two ways

    1)If you are authorized to access individual kits by logging on to them using their password
    In Gap, go to My Account > Kit Authorization
    Enter kit number and password for each kit.

    2)If you do not have password for kits,
    Go to Project Administration > Project Profile
    There will be a Join link address, copy it and send to member you would like to join. They will have to logged into kit and then paste address into address bar.

    You may then have to accept request under project Administration > Join Authorization

              There will be two join link addresses in your project profile page (GAP > Project Administration > Project profile)

              I just tried adding kit.

              Use the Returning Join link
              Copy and paste into address bar after logging out of GAP and signing into kit (easier to use separate Browsers, then you do not have to log out of GAP)
              Fill in form
              Go back to Gap and go to Project Administration > join Authorization
              View Join Requests
              Click on Read beside the Name , message will appear at bottom of list, click on Reply > accept Request
              Go to My Account > Kit Authorization and Add kit and password (may have to wait a period for system to recognize kit part of project before doing this step)

                HOWEVER - next question -- Is that actually necessary?
                ie, it says "to enable full access to a kit, you need the kit number and password" But - how much is available without "full access"? What additional does one have with "full access"?

                  With out full access one can only view account and matches, can not change or download Raw Data, ect. Would have to log on to each account separately to access and change data. Full access is not necessary but if managing accounts it makes it easier.

                  Feature Read Only Limited Full
                  Change mtDNA Match Notifications × ✓ ✓
                  Change YDNA Match Notifications × ✓ ✓
                  Edit Contact Information × ✓* ✓
                  Edit Personal Profile Photo × ✓ ✓
                  Set myOrigins Survey × ✓ ✓
                  Change Facts & Genes Newsletter Subscription × × ✓
                  Change mtDNA CR Display Settings × × ✓
                  Change Password × × ✓
                  Change Project Administrator Settings × × ✓
                  Change Project Email Settings × × ✓
                  Download Family Finder Raw Data × × ✓
                  Download mtDNA FASTA File × × ✓
                  Edit Beneficiary Information × × ✓
                  Edit Family Finder Linked Relationships × × ✓
                  Edit Personal Profile Information × × ✓
                  Leave Projects × × ✓
                  * Except your primary email address
